Most researchers agree that the nameBARNEY camefrom the small town of Berney (pronounced "Barney," and usuallyspelled Barney today) in Norfolk Co., England. Many have said the name isNorman, possibly derived from the norse BJARNE, meaning "Bear". The , founded byWilliamC. Barney in 1979, now has over 400 members, mostly in the United Statesand Canada, but also in Mexico, Colombia, Australia and England. In 1990, the association published theauthoritative reference of Barney history and genealogy, theGenealogy of the Barney Family in America.
